LSAL
82: Zialo: the Newly-Discovered
Mande
Language of Guinea
Kirill Babaev
Russian
Academy of Science,
Moscow
The book
is the first grammar
description of the newly discovered language of Zialo, spoken by some
25,000
people in the Republic of Guinea in West Africa. The language belongs
to the
South-Western group of the Mande language family. Before 2010, no
grammar,
article or vocabulary of Zialo was ever published.
The book
presents a survey of the
language according to the contemporary standards of language
descriptions. Phonology,
morphonology, tonology, morphology and syntax are analysed, with a
specific
focus to the syntactic structure of the language. The book also gives a
brief
insight into the linguistic geography of Zialo, its dialectal
diversity,
neighbours and language contacts.
The description is supported by over 600
phrasal
examples, all of which are fully glossed according to the Leipzig rules
of
glossing. All word or phrase examples throughout the text are fully
tone-marked. The grammar is followed by Appendices including three
sample texts
in Zialo with glosses, he 100-item Swadesh list of basic lexicon, and
the Zialo
to English and French vocabulary, consisting of over 2,000 entries.
The
bibliography list covers
about 200 reference papers. The book contains two maps (of the
South-Western
Mande languages, and the Zialo language), three diagrams and over 30
charts.
ISBN
9783862880164 (Hardbound).
LINCOM Studies in African Linguistics 82. 260pp.
2010.
